Add 27/2 and 14/21
1st number: 13 1/2, 2nd number: 14/21
27/2 + 14/21 is 85/6.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 2 and 21 is 42
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 42 - For the 1st fraction, since 2 × 21 = 42,
27/2 = 27 × 21/2 × 21 = 567/42 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 21 × 2 = 42,
14/21 = 14 × 2/21 × 2 = 28/42 - Add the two like fractions:
567/42 + 28/42 = 567 + 28/42 = 595/42 - 595/42 simplified gives 85/6
- So, 27/2 + 14/21 = 85/6
